Located in the valley of Cap Vermell on the north-east coast of Mallorca, the Park Hyatt Mallorca is the newest addition to the brand. Boutique guest rooms range from 50sqm to a 150sqm and each feature a private balcony. Leisure facilities at the hotel range from the water-based adrenaline rush of kayaking, surfing and diving, to the more leisurely spa experience and poolside lounging along with access to the nearby country club and golf courses close by. Restaurants are varied and include social spots, tapas and Asian fusion with a revolving menu.

Jumeirah Port Sóller is offered by the same hotel group who bring us the Burj al Arab in Dubai. Situated in the Sóller Valley amongst the Unesco World Heritage Tramuntana Mountain range. There is a choice of rooms and suites available, most with terrace or balcony. There are five restaurants and bars and dining choices include regional and international cooking. The resort has 3 heated swimming pools (adults only, family friendly and a spa hydro-pool), a spa and a fitness centre.
